What conventions of the comedy genre does "Game Night" (2018) have? "Game Night" follows the conventions of the comedy genre through its use of humor, wit, and comedic situations. The film employs a mix of verbal and situational comedy, with a fast-paced and engaging storyline that keeps the audience entertained. The characters find themselves in absurd and humorous situations, often driven by misunderstandings and unexpected twists, which are typical elements of the comedy genre. What titles are displayed during the opening sequences? The opening titles of "The Game" employ bold typography, dark color schemes, and dynamic transitions. This combination creates a foreboding atmosphere typical of thrillers, immediately signaling to the audience the suspenseful nature of the narrative. What images are prioritized in the opening sequence? The film strategically prioritizes suspenseful visuals, incorporating cryptic symbols and shadowy scenes. These elements serve as effective hooks, drawing the audience into the enigmatic narrative right from the beginning. How does the film establish a feeling of the genre from the outset? "The Game" fulfills the thriller genre through a strategic mix of dark color palettes, haunting music, and impactful visual motifs. There were many things I noticed after giving the video about 5 re-watches. Not all being good, for instance there were some black frames, off center clips, and even quality inconsistencies. I'm going to be going though how I fixed all of those as well. For the black frames I had noticed, they weren't a very big issue. I just had to select the remainder past where the frame was, and scooch everything past that forward to make it seamless.
